Вопрос или проблема
После обновления с 24.04 до 24.10 загрузка застревает в цикле, прямо перед экраном входа. Я могу двигать мышью на черном экране, но страница обновляется каждые несколько секунд, показывая мигающий курсор в верхней части экрана.
- Ядро 6.11.0-12-generic
Когда загружается Ubuntu, появляется сообщение об ошибке :
ee1004 3-0050: probe with driver ee1004 failed with error -5
- Обновил BIOS на моем Asus TUF GAMING B550-PLUS
- Добавил nomodeset в GRUB.
- Попробовал использовать более старое ядро 6.8.0-50-generic
- Видеокарта – Radeon RX 580
Есть идеи?
Большое спасибо
ОБНОВЛЕНИЕ:
После смены lightdm на gdm3 и перезагрузки, я смог нормально войти с интерфейсом входа gdm.
sudo dpkg-reconfigure gdm3
Ответ или решение
Данная проблема с загрузкой Ubuntu после обновления до версии 24.10 представляет собой довольно распространенную ситуацию, особенно когда обновление затрагивает компоненты графической системы и драйверы.
Обзор проблемы
Пользователь столкнулся со следующей ситуацией: после обновления с версии 24.04 до 24.10 система зависает на черном экране с мигающим курсором, что не позволяет ему войти в систему. При этом на этапе загрузки появляется ошибка, связанная с драйвером ee1004.
Шаги, предпринятые для решения проблемы
Пользователь выполнил несколько диагностических шагов:
- Обновление BIOS: Установка последней версии BIOS на материнской плате Asus TUF GAMING B550-PLUS может помочь в совместимости с новыми обновлениями ядра и драйверами.
- Использование параметра nomodeset: Данный параметр предотвращает загрузку графических драйверов до завершения начальной загрузки системы, позволяя обойти некоторые проблемы совместимости с видеокартами.
- Попытка переключения на более старое ядро (6.8.0-50-generic): Старые версии ядра могут работать более стабильно с определенными конфигурациями аппаратуры.
- Замена дисплейного менеджера: Переход от lightdm к gdm3, который, как оказалось, помог пользователю войти в систему.
Возможные рекомендации для дальнейшего решения проблемы
-
Проверьте совместимость драйверов: С учетом того, что ошибка связана с драйвером ee1004, рекомендуется проверить, установлены ли последние версии драйверов для видеокарты Radeon RX 580. Используйте команду:
sudo apt update sudo apt upgrade
-
Дополнительные параметры загрузки: Попробуйте добавить другие параметры загрузки (например,
acpi=off
илиnoapic
), чтобы устранить возможные конфликты с аппаратным обеспечением. -
Проверка системы на сбои: Загрузитесь в аварийном режиме (recovery mode) и выполните проверку целостности файловой системы с помощью команды:
fsck -f /
-
Логирование и диагностика: После успешного входа в систему с gdm3, проверьте системные логи на наличие ошибок и предупреждений:
journalctl -b -1
-
Удаление конфликтующих пакетов: Если в системе есть старые или конфликтующие пакеты, это также может привести к неполадкам. Рассмотрите возможность удаления ненужных пакетов:
sudo apt remove <имя_пакета>
-
Виртуальные среды: Рассмотрите возможность использования виртуальной среды (например, VirtualBox или VMware) для тестирования обновлений перед их применением на основной системе.
Заключение
Обновление операционной системы — это сложный процесс, который может привести к неожиданным проблемам. Важно подходить к каждому шагу с осторожностью и системно. Решения, предложенные выше, направлены на устранение проблемы с черным экраном и ее возможных причин. Постоянный мониторинг обновлений драйверов и системного ПО поможет поддерживать работоспособность системы на должном уровне в будущем.